Transaction e720816a6356fecd9ac5e52f2faa106d0a7dec32e82a8f9a822cf15a0b570139

3 Input
1 Outputs
  • e720816a6356fecd9ac5e52f2faa106d0a7dec32e82a8f9a822cf15a0b570139:0
  • value  22250000
    address  1FR3HcxkwQR15WctENxeKJTiGKkavcXoeF